Why Use a Budgeting App in 2025?

In a time of rising costs and digital banking, budgeting apps help Canadians track spending, reduce debt, and plan for the future. Whether you're a student, freelancer, or family, these apps can automate your savings journey.


1. Mint by Intuit (Canada Version)




A free all-in-one financial tracker that connects to your bank accounts and auto-categorizes your transactions.

  • Features: Bill reminders, budgeting, credit score monitoring.
  • Best For: Beginners and everyday users.
  • Price: Free


2. YNAB (You Need A Budget)



A proactive budgeting app that helps users give “every dollar a job” with powerful planning tools.

  • Features: Goal tracking, real-time syncing, debt payoff planning.
  • Best For: Serious budgeters and couples.
  • Price: Free trial, then ~$14.99/month


3. PocketGuard




Helps you know exactly how much you can spend daily after accounting for bills and savings.

  • Features: “In My Pocket” feature, subscriptions tracking, savings goals.
  • Best For: Impulse spenders or those with variable income.
  • Price: Free, Premium available


 4. KOHO



A Canadian mobile banking app that doubles as a budgeting tool with cashback and savings features.

  • Features: Prepaid Visa, spending insights, cashback rewards.
  • Best For: Everyday budgeting + spending.
  • Price: Free basic, premium version available


5. Spendee



A beautiful app to track shared budgets, perfect for families, roommates, or couples.

  • Features: Multi-wallet support, colorful charts, joint budgeting.
  • Best For: Visual thinkers and shared finances.
  • Price: Free with in-app purchases


6. Goodbudget


A digital envelope budgeting system ideal for those who like planning ahead and tracking cash flow.

  • Features: Sync across devices, envelope system, debt tracking.
  • Best For: Manual budgeters and cash envelope fans.
  • Price: Free and Plus Plan (~$8/month)


7. Emma



A UK/US/CA-friendly app that tracks subscriptions, spending patterns, and offers smart budgeting tips.

  • Features: Subscription tracking, insights, cashback.
  • Best For: Subscription management and lifestyle budgets.
  • Price: Free and Pro Plans


8. Wally



An intelligent budget and expense tracker with strong currency conversion for Canadian travelers and expats.

  • Features: Group budgeting, multi-currency support.
  • Best For: Frequent travelers, students, and professionals.
  • Price: Free and Premium


9. Simplifi by Quicken


Real-time budgeting and spending plans with top-notch design and insights from the makers of Quicken.

  • Features: Spending plans, investment tracking, goal setting.
  • Best For: Professionals and investors.
  • Price: ~$3.99/month billed annually


10. Moka (Formerly Mylo)



A Canadian micro-investing and savings app that rounds up your purchases and invests the spare change.

  • Features: Automated investing, goal-based saving.
  • Best For: Passive savers and investors.
  • Price: $3.99/month
